Driving directionsFrom Silverthorne, Colorado on Interstate 70 take exit 205 and go 22.4 miles north on Colorado Highway 9. The campground is near the mid-point of Green Mountain Reservoir. The entrance is on the left just before mile marker 124. From Kremmling, Colorado, turn off Highway 40 onto Colorado Highway 9 South and go 15.1 miles. The campground is near the mid-point of Green Mountain Reservoir. The entrance is on the right, just beyond mile marker 124.
Access via Colorado Highway 9 is straightforward, with well-maintained roads leading to the campground. However, site access can be challenging when roads are wet, as mentioned in the official details.
Nearby places
Silverthorne (22.4 miles, approximately 30 minutes), Kremmling (15.1 miles, approximately 20 minutes).
Nearby supplies
Groceries, camping supplies, and fuel are accessible in Silverthorne (22.4 miles away) or Kremmling (15.1 miles). Firewood is available onsite for $8 cash or cashier’s check.

Activities you can enjoy

Cow Creek South Campground caters to diverse recreational interests. Popular activities include boating, canoeing, fishing, water skiing, hiking, and off-road vehicle exploration. Wildlife viewing is also a highlight, with opportunities to observe bighorn sheep, elk, and other species.
HikingHiking trails are available near the campground, including picturesque routes like Lower Cataract Lake that offer views of fall colors and aspen groves.
FishingFishing options include rainbow and brown trout, kokanee salmon, and cutthroat trout. Users noted challenges due to pike populations affecting smaller fish.
SwimmingSwimming is possible in Green Mountain Reservoir, but users recommend shoes due to rocky conditions or broken glass.
BoatingBoating is a major attraction, with motorized watercraft requiring inspections for aquatic nuisance species. Canoeing and kayaking are also popular.
Wildlife viewingWildlife abounds in the area, including bighorn sheep, elk, pika, and ptarmigan. Scenic rivers sustain trout populations.
Beach activitiesBeach-related activities are available, but the water level changes seasonally. Some sites offer private beaches.

Policies & Safety

Hazards & AlertsWindstorms are common, and the reservoir water levels fluctuate significantly. Wildlife such as bears necessitates the use of bear-proof lockers.
Active AlertsActive alerts include seasonal water level changes and potential fire restrictions.
No Potable WaterThis campground does not have potable water on-site. Bring all the water you need for drinking, cooking, and cleaning.
Food Storage RequiredBear-proof lockers provided at each site for safe food storage.
